Get to know Miami’s 2020 recruiting class: Local DE Samuel Anaele is rapidly improving

Samuel Anaele had been playing football less than a year when he committed to the Hurricanes last winter.

He first came to the United States from Nigeria in early 2017 and didn’t officially suit up for a game until Norland’s spring game against Booker T. Washington the same year.

The defensive lineman had all the physical gifts in the world, but he didn’t really know what he was doing.

Still, Anaele logged a pair of sacks and his recruitment was off. He committed to his new hometown team less than a year later and has remained firm in his commitment to the Hurricanes since.
